Key Features to Look for in Pinterest Automation Tools

When selecting a Pinterest automation tool for your WordPress site, several features are essential to ensure smooth workflow and effective traffic growth.

Automatic pin creation from WordPress content is a core feature. This allows your latest posts, pages, or products to be turned into pins without manual effort, saving time and maintaining consistency.

Scheduling and posting at optimal times is another key feature. Tools that analyze audience engagement and automatically post when your followers are most active help maximize reach and click-throughs.

Seamless integration between WordPress and Pinterest ensures that your automation works smoothly. Plugins or tools that connect directly with your WordPress site reduce errors, maintain formatting, and allow easy pin creation from the content editor.

Analytics and tracking of pin performance is essential for understanding what works. Look for tools that provide metrics such as impressions, clicks, saves, and traffic referrals, so you can refine your strategy.

Compatibility with WordPress themes, plugins, and e-commerce features is also important. If you run a WooCommerce store or use page builders, your automation tool must integrate without breaking layouts or interfering with other plugins.

Finally, consider data privacy, API access, and platform compliance. Ensure your tool follows Pinterest’s guidelines, protects your user data, and maintains API integrity to avoid account restrictions or penalties.

By focusing on these features, you can choose a Pinterest automation tool that saves time, boosts traffic, and complements your WordPress site effectively.

3. Top Pinterest Automation Tools for WordPress in 2025

When growing your WordPress site and driving traffic from Pinterest, automation tools help you save time and stay consistent. Here are some top tools worth considering.

Zapier offers no‑code workflows that connect WordPress and Pinterest. It supports triggers like “New WordPress post published” that automatically create a Pin on Pinterest. Many marketing teams and bloggers trust it because it’s flexible and integrates with thousands of apps. Zapier+1
Pabbly Connect is a similar automation platform that supports Pinterest integrations among many other apps. It allows you to build workflows that trigger when WordPress content is published, and then post that content to Pinterest boards. Pabbly+1
Make (formerly Integromat) is a visual automation tool where you can map more complex workflows between WordPress and Pinterest. It’s ideal for teams that need branching logic or multi‑step tasks.
Albato is another workflow builder that may appeal to users wanting a simpler interface for connecting WordPress and Pinterest.
MESA highlights pre‑built automation templates created especially for e‑commerce, content publishing and social sharing, making it easier to get started.
Post2Pin is a newer tool focused on AI‑powered pin creation from WordPress blogs. It’s designed for publishers who want to automatically generate pinned visuals and link them back to their posts.
Beyond these, it’s worth keeping an eye on additional emerging plugins and integrations that target WordPress–Pinterest workflows, as the ecosystem evolves quickly.


4. How to Choose the Right Automation Tool for Your WordPress Site

Selecting the right Pinterest automation tool means matching your needs, testing carefully, and ensuring everything works smoothly with your WordPress setup.

Begin by assessing your workflow: what needs automating and how often? If you publish blog posts or products and want them instantly pinned, choose a tool that supports automatic triggers from WordPress to Pinterest.
Consider the cost versus the return on investment. Some tools may offer many integrations but cost more months later. If your Pinterest traffic is a key growth channel, a higher‑tier tool may make sense; if it’s occasional, a simpler one may suffice.
Test performance and check if your automation tool impacts your site’s speed. Because automation platforms often rely on API calls or external servers, make sure your WordPress hosting handles them without slowing your site.
Ensure compatibility with your theme, plugins and WordPress version. Some automation tools may conflict with social‑sharing plugins, caching, or security setups. Running tests on a staging site gives you confidence before going live.
Finally, use a staging environment before full launch. Configure the tool in a safe setting, simulate your publishing workflow and verify that Pinterest boards are receiving the correct content, the right images, and links. This reduces the risk of mis‑posts or broken workflow on your live site.

Best Practices for Using Pinterest Automation with WordPress

Using Pinterest automation can save time, but it must be done carefully to avoid penalties and maximize engagement. Always maintain originality in your pins. Avoid spamming the same content repeatedly, as Pinterest may flag accounts that appear overly automated.

Focus on high-quality visuals and well-written pin descriptions. Pins with eye-catching images, readable text overlays, and clear links to your WordPress content perform better and attract more clicks.

Monitor analytics and adjust your strategy based on data. Track metrics like impressions, saves, clicks, and traffic to your website. Use these insights to refine your pinning schedule, design, and messaging.

Regularly update your workflows and tools. Pinterest and WordPress both evolve constantly, so make sure your automation setup stays compatible and effective. Outdated workflows can lead to errors or missed posting opportunities.

Finally, stay compliant with Pinterest’s terms of service. Automation tools must follow platform rules, especially regarding posting frequency, API use, and content ownership. Compliance protects your account and ensures long-term success.

FAQs

Can I Automate Pinterest Pins Without a Plugin?
Yes, you can use web-based automation platforms like Zapier or Make without installing a WordPress plugin. However, using a plugin often makes the integration smoother and reduces technical steps.

Will Automation Hurt My Pinterest Account or Get Flagged?
Automation is safe as long as you follow Pinterest’s terms of service. Avoid spamming the same pins repeatedly and keep posting at reasonable intervals. Using approved tools reduces risk.

Which Tool Is Best for WooCommerce Product Pins?
Tools like MESA, Pabbly Connect, and Post2Pin work well for WooCommerce stores. They can automatically create pins from product pages, include pricing, and link directly to your store.

How Much Time Does Automation Really Save?
Depending on your posting frequency, automation can save several hours per week. For blogs or stores with frequent content, it eliminates manual pin creation and scheduling, freeing you to focus on strategy and content creation.

Do These Tools Work Globally (Outside U.S./Europe)?
Yes. Most automation tools support WordPress and Pinterest globally. Your success may depend on local Pinterest availability, API access, and hosting speed, but these tools are designed for international use.
